Frankfurt
BMW is close to unveiling a development partnership for autonomous cars with Israeli collision detection software maker Mobileye and US chip maker Intel, a source familiar with the matter said on Thursday.
On Friday, the three companies plan to hold a joint news conference, with BMW Group chief executive Harald Krueger, Intel CEO Brian Krzanich and Mobileye chairman and chief technology officer Amnon Shashua detailing the partnership.
